How much does it cost to rent a home in Pisgah?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Pisgah 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,435 | $900 | $2,250 |
| Pisgah 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,867 | $1,400 | $3,200 |
| Pisgah 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,440 | $1,795 | $3,450 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Pisgah
What type of rentals are currently available in Pisgah?
There are currently 46 Apartments for Rent in Pisgah, IA with pricing that ranges from $660 to $2,300. There are also 38 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Pisgah ranging from $900 to $3,450.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Pisgah?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Pisgah ranges from $900 to $3,450 with an average monthly rent of $1,689.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Pisgah?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Pisgah range from $1,335 to $2,300,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,400 to $3,200.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,795 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,852.
